The Tactical Radars and Effectors department within Raytheon Hardware Engineering supports the development, production, and deployment of multiple defense products including radars, missiles, command and control systems, and naval electronics. The products support US Government and international customers.
This Mechanical Engineer Product Team role will support the Sentinel radar product line based in Fullerton, CA and may require domestic and international travel to suppliers. This position will be an onsite role.
